An idyllic rural retreat for all the family nestling in the rolling hills and valleys of the South Hams, an area of outstanding natural beauty. The rural hamlet of Devon cottage, Belsford Court, is close to the pretty village of Harberton with its 13th cent Church House Inn serving great beers and food, and its historic church and buldings.
We are centrally located for access to the historic towns of Totnes (10 mins by car): voted one of the world's top 10 funkiest towns by British Airways and the capital of new age chic in Time magazine, Dartmouth, Kingsbridge, Salcombe and Modbury. Explore the
wonderful coastline at Blackpool Sands, Bantham and Bigbury. Walk the Yealm, Erme, Avon, Salcombe/Kingsbridge and the Dart estuaries and the wild open spaces of Dartmoor National Park. Enjoy the sea side fun of Torquay, Paignton and Brixham. Close by are Plymouth and Exeter. There are numerous other picturesque villages, pubs, restaurants attractions and places to visit within the surrounding area.
We are at the end of the lane: 'Heaven in Devon'. No passing traffic only tractors, sheep, cows, horses and an abundance of
wildlife, over looking the peace and tranquillity of the Harbourne Valley and open countryside. The six cottages are within traditional Devon stone barns arranged around a central courtyard and converted to a high standard set within 3.5 acres of private grounds including a stream, wild flower meadow, copse and picnic area. Facilities include indoor heated swimming pool, sauna, hot tub, games room, children's play/games areas and barbecue.
